How Much Would You Pay For Peace of Mind?

We recently posted an infographic (below in case you missed it) that surfaced some interesting data about data loss and the frequency of backing up your hard drive.

Take a moment and think about this factoid – “54% of adults personally have and/or know someone who has lost files.”

When you toss in that “25% of people never backup their hard drive”, it’s easy to predict that our support staff will be getting some colorful calls in the near future.

While the graphic doesn’t specifically call out why people don’t backup their data, one theory that I’ve heard time and again is the concern that it’ll be too difficult.
